How to Buy the Presale Tickets for Coachella 2023

The dates of the event, how to purchase presale or advance tickets to Coachella 2023, and the prices for the various purchasing options are all listed below. Coachella 2023 ticket pre-sales started at 10 a.m. PT today, Friday, June 17, 2022. 

Depending on how you look at it, that is either very late at night or very early in the morning in Australia. That is 1 p.m. ET, 5 p.m. GMT. 

The ticketing system used by Coachella has been changed. AXS is the sole operator of this year’s version. 

All ages are welcome at Coachella 2023, as it is each year. Additionally, children under the age of five are admitted free of charge to the festival. 

The festival is scheduled for the weekends of 14-16 April (weekend one) and 21-23 April in 2019. (weekend two). Both festival weekends will have the same lineup, artwork, food, and activities. 

A maximum of four (4) weekend passes may be purchased per weekend by ticket holders. In other words, you’ll need to purchase your tickets in two batches if you’re travelling in a group of five (or more). 

The price of your Coachella 2023 ticket can wildly, depending on what level of luxury you wish to enjoy (and can afford).

Three-day passes to weekend one start at $537, according to All Festival Tickets; weekend two comes cheaper, at $474.

According to the Coachella website, general admission passes for one weekend of the festival in 2023 can cost $499 (with fees – that’s tier 1), $549 (tier 2), or $599. (tier 3). 

Tier 1 or Tier 2 VIP passes cost $1,069 (plus fees); camping is $149 (plus a transient occupancy tax) (TOT). 

There are also the deluxe choices. Two tickets and the opportunity to stay in one of Coachella’s Lake Eldorado Lodges are available for $2,798. 

Additionally, the highest-priced festival tickets for Coachella 2023 starts at an astounding $9,000. The “ultimate on-site camping experience” is what Safari Camping claims to be. Find out more details about that here.
